Spot boring and the tools associated with it, such as the spot face drill bit and carbide spot drill, are also vital elements in the machining toolkit. A spot drill bit is created to produce a small, shallow opening that offers as an overview for a full-sized drill bit, guaranteeing accuracy and avoiding the drill from strolling throughout the workpiece.

The layout and form of the end mill also significantly impact its efficiency. The 2 flute end mill, as an example, is particularly reliable in reducing softer metals and non-metallic products. Its style enables bigger chip clearance, lowering the probability of clogging and making it possible for smoother procedure. Solid carbide end mills are one more category of devices that master robustness and reducing precision. These end mills are made from a solitary item of carbide, providing superior solidity and use resistance contrasted to covered devices. Solid carbide end mills are commonly used in sectors requiring high accuracy and effectiveness, such as aerospace and mold-making.
